    The Link Between Excess Weight and Prediabetes

    Carrying extra weight, especially around the abdomen, directly impacts insulin resistance, which is the key mechanism behind prediabetes. Studies consistently show that even a modest reduction in body weight can significantly improve blood sugar control and insulin sensitivity. Medical weight loss programs take this a step further by addressing the underlying metabolic dysfunctions rather than just focusing on calorie counting.

    In these settings, patients often undergo diagnostic testing and receive personalized plans supervised by healthcare providers. Structured interventions also reduce inflammation, which plays a critical role in insulin resistance.

    Benefits of a Supervised Medical Approach

    Unlike conventional dieting, medical weight loss involves careful monitoring and clinical support that adjusts the strategy based on how your body responds. This ensures both safety and success. One of the core benefits lies in how tailored plans optimize nutrition while avoiding fad diets or extreme restrictions.

    Many individuals starting their journey often ask what a medical weight loss program is, especially when considering it as a solution to prediabetes. These programs typically include metabolic assessments, supervised nutrition plans, behavior therapy, and sometimes prescription medications when necessary. This comprehensive framework increases adherence and produces measurable improvements in blood sugar levels.

    Additionally, the structured environment helps prevent plateaus and frustration that often derail self-managed efforts. Consistent progress encourages long-term behavioral change, which is essential for reversing prediabetes.
